#380208 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#380208 is composed of 22% red, 0.8% green and 3.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 96.4% magenta, 85.7% yellow and 78% black. It has a hue angle of 353.3 degrees, a saturation of 93.1% and a lightness of 11.4%. #380208 color hex could be obtained by blending #700410 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#330000.

Shades and Tints of #380208
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#120103 is the darkest color, while #fffefe is the lightest one.
